
Transforming the Future of AI Agents with Amazon Bedrock AgentCore
In today’s tech-centric world, the rise of AI agents promises to revolutionize workflows and enhance our daily interactions. One of the pivotal tools empowering this transformation is Amazon Bedrock AgentCore, specifically through its AgentCore Identity offering. This service is tailored for developers eager to build sophisticated AI agents while ensuring security and seamless integration with existing enterprise systems.
The Foundation: What is AgentCore Identity?
At its core, Amazon Bedrock AgentCore Identity is designed for managing the identities of AI agents. Organizations can leverage this centralized system to manage agent identities proactively while securing sensitive credentials that are essential for functionality. This platform provides a flexible infrastructure that allows AI agents to operate confidently in a cloud environment without compromising on security.
Key Features of AgentCore Identity
Amazon Bedrock AgentCore Identity packs a variety of features that cater to the unique requirements of AI agents:
- Centralized Identity Management: This feature acts as a single source of truth for managing various agent identities, ensuring streamlined operations across diverse platforms.
- Token Vault: With capabilities to securely store and manage OAuth tokens, API keys, and client credentials, AgentCore Identity ensures that the right access controls are in place.
- OAuth 2.0 Flow Support: The service simplifies OAuth integration, allowing developers to access AWS resources and third-party services easily.
- Identity-Aware Authorization: This allows AI agents to operate based on the context of the user, forwarding essential tokens while maintaining appropriate access levels.
Subject-Matter Expert Perspective
In a recent blog post on AWS Security, developers insightfully articulated how AgentCore Identity addresses pressing security challenges faced by organizations implementing AI solutions. These challenges often revolve around the secure management of user identities and credentials. By ensuring agents can only access the data necessary for their operations, the potential for unauthorized access is significantly reduced.
Real-World Application: A Case Study
Consider a scenario where a company is developing an AI agent to assist users in scheduling appointments via Google Calendar. Through the integrated features of AgentCore Identity, the AI agent can secure credentials to access the Google Calendar API on behalf of the user seamlessly. The agent uses OAuth 2.0 flows, capturing the user’s authorization and securely managing tokens, thus streamlining the booking process while safeguarding the user’s personal data.
Embracing the Future of AI
The demand for robust AI solutions is skyrocketing, driven by organizations keen to leverage automation. As AI agents become integral to everyday operations, ensuring secure identity management is paramount. With Amazon Bedrock AgentCore Identity, companies can confidently expand their AI initiatives with strong security frameworks that foster trust and reliability.
Actionable Insights for Developers
For developers interested in taking advantage of this technology, a variety of resources are available. The AWS Developer Guide offers detailed instructions on integrating AgentCore Identity into your projects. Engaging with example use cases can also help unfamiliar developers to explore the depth of what AgentCore Identity has to offer. By building your AI agent with AgentCore, you position yourself to tackle complex workflows while leading innovation in your field.
Write A Comment